Abstract
Polarized neutron reflectometry was performed on a [Fe3O4/NiO](x15) mu ltilayer, molecular beam epitaxy grown on a (001) MgO substrate, in bo th exchange biased and nonexchange biased states. The Fe3O4 layers exh ibit a depth-dependent magnetic profile characterized by a change in t he magnetization near the Fe3O4/NiO interfaces. In the exchange biased state, measurements performed in the two saturated states of the magn etic hysteresis loop reveal magnetic differences in the Fe3O4, possibl y due to the interfacial domain wall formation in the ferromagnetic la yer.
